Re: Making your own 2 part and Mg supplements

Just a word of caution. Most calcium chloride is made by Dow. Dow has decided they no long have the need for the bromide that is usually removed. They will now be leaving the bromide where they found it. This basicly means that the amout of bromide will be very very high by comparison to NSW. This change is from 150ppm to 8000ppm. What this will effect is still up in the air.
